Default No trunk release... STUCK! 89 Accord damn it what do I do???!!!

Thanks for looking... My sister's 89 Accord 4 door: I guess some crackhead wanted to get into the trunk (Why?!). Well it didn't open for him, and now it doesn't open for anyone. The lever release does nothing and the key turns in the back but won't open. The rear seats don't fold down, which really surprised me and seems like a design flaw... What's the best way to get back there so I can fix the problem?

I'd really like to help my sister out here, so if she gets a flat tire, she can get into the trunk to change it. Also she's lugging all her **** in the back seat now which won't be great if she gets into an accident. Thanks ppl

the rear seats should fold down. I know there's a lever in the trunk to release the seat, which obviously isn't going to help you here, but there's also a keyhole near the center of the rear deck, between the speakers. Insert key, turn clockwise, and then you should be able to fold down the seat.

If it is a DX the rear seats won't fold down. Did you make sure that the trunk release lever was unlocked when you pulled it? you may also remove the Trim around the release levers and use a pair of pliers to try and pull the cable farther if the lever is not moving far enough. Also try pressing down on the trunk lid while pulling the lever. If it comes down to it you could unblot the top of the rear seat(if DX) and crawl into the trunk to try and fix the problem(If it is a DX and you want the diagram of where the bolts are let me know and I can get the pic for you).
